Waveney Tournament Report
Sunday 22nd marked our second preseason competitive tournament at Waveney (Lowestoft). Once again the boys did me, Steve and the club proud. After an initial shaky start they qualified top of their group with three wins, 1 draw and a defeat (to the old nemesis St Benets). The team faced Waveney Lions in the quarter final and managed to win a tight fought game 2-1 to progress to the semis. In the semis the team met Breydon Utd who they’d draw 0-0 with in the group stage. Again the game was hard fought and ended 1-1, despite Jimmy having a freekick cleared off the line and Ben shooting narrowly wide luck was not with us. This meant that once again we found ourselves in a penalty shootout, however this time it was not meant to be and the boys lost out 2-0.
